A recent incident on I-40 East highlighted the dangers encountered by first responders on our nation's highways. On Sunday afternoon, a Knoxville Police Department cruiser was involved in a multi-vehicle accident while conducting a traffic stop near Alcoa Highway. According to WVLT, dashcam footage captured the moment a minivan, merging out of the right lane, collided with the parked police vehicle.

The driver of the minivan was cited for failing to maintain lanes and for the failure to move over for emergency vehicles. In a statement obtained by WBIR, KPD underscored the "real dangers for first responders, especially on the interstate." The same sentiment was echoed by the department as they urged motorists to "ALWAYS pay attention to the road, and to please slow down and move over for emergency vehicles."

Though no serious injuries were reported, the officer whose cruiser was struck received treatment for minor wounds at the University of Tennessee Medical Center, and was later released, as noted by WATE. The minivan driver was taken to a hospital for evaluation, with a KPD spokesperson suggesting that the individual may have been suffering from a medical emergency at the time of the accident.
